Snow early this morning will change to freezing rain. Up to one
tenth of an inch of ice accumulation is possible before
temperatures warm above freezing this afternoon.

Precautionary/preparedness actions...

A Freezing Rain Advisory means that periods of freezing rain or
freezing drizzle will cause travel difficulties. Be prepared for
slippery roads. Slow down and use caution while driving.
